Aim of the subject

Introducing students to the definitions of management, history of management, organizational structures, manager’s tasks, managers, quantitative methods in management, the importance of finance and accounting for managers in computer science.

Knowledge and skills

Upon completion of the course student is expected to be able to fit into a company and to be able to recognize the organizational structure.

Lectures content

Nature and development of the management theory. Definitions of management. Scientific management. Principles of organization. Methods of organization. The influence of internal and external factors on the organization. Organizational structures. Modern trends in the shaping of an organization. Relationship of the organizational structure and management. Division of the management. Levels of management. Strategic Management. Missions and goals.

Lectures are presented through audio-visual presentations using modern teaching aids (projector, video, audio, smart board).

Exercises are performed in couples, triads and separately using audio and video records for later analysis and feedback. Exercises also include group discussions, debates and separate presentations performed by students.

MINIMUM LEARNING OUTCOMES

  1. To define management, its functions, activities and manager roles and to enumerate management skills.
  2. To explain internal and external company environment.
  3. To define planning, strategy and strategic management and enumerate different levels and types of planning.
  4. To define the concept , process and models of decision making and to enumerate decision making techniques.
  5. To define the concept and the content of organizing, to recognize organizational structure forms.  
  6. To define the concept and the meaning of staff, to describe recruiting, selection, training and staff development and to enumerate performance assessment methods.  
  7. To define basic leadership features, to enumerate leadership models and motivation theories.  
  8. To define control process and enumerate control methods and techniques.

DESIRED LEARNING OUTCOMES

  1. To explain management, its functions, activities and manager roles and to enumerate management skills.
  2. To compare internal and external company environment and to apply company environment analysis.
  3. To explain planning, levels and types of planning, strategy and strategic management and to create organizational orientation of a company.
  4. To apply certain decision making techniques (problem solving techniques and game theory in clear strategies and perfect information games).
  5. To explain organizational structure forms.
  6. To describe performance assessment methods.
  7. To compare leadership models and to recognize sources and methods of conflict solving.
  8. To explain levels of performance benchmark control.
